The size of Anglesea is approximately 96.9 square kilometres. There are 17 parks, covering nearly 86.6% of the total area. The population of Anglesea in 2016 was 2545 people. By 2021 the population was 3208 showing a population growth of 26.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Anglesea is 60-69 years. Households in Anglesea are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Anglesea work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 77.10% of the homes in Anglesea were owner-occupied compared with 75.30% in 2016.
